UI 与 JavaScript:打造动态且交互式用户界面的指南283


在当今快节奏的数字世界中,吸引人和交互式的用户界面 (UI) 已成为数字产品的核心要素。用户希望与网站、应用程序和软件无缝交互,而 JavaScript 在实现这一目标方面发挥着至关重要的作用。

JavaScript 在 UI 设计中的作用

JavaScript 是一种广泛使用的编程语言,用于创建和控制 Web 浏览器中的动态内容。在 UI 设计中,JavaScript 可以执行以下任务:
元素操作:创建、删除、修改 HTML 和 CSS 元素,实现页面布局和元素样式的动态更改。
事件处理:监听用户交互,例如点击、鼠标悬停和滚动,并触发相应的操作。
数据处理:与服务器端交互,获取和更新数据,以实现实时的应用程序体验。
表单验证:验证用户输入,确保数据的准确性和完整性。

UI 设计中的 JavaScript 技术

有许多 JavaScript 技术可用于构建动态 UI,包括:
jQuery:一个用于简化 DOM 元素操作、事件处理和 AJAX 请求的库。
Vanilla JavaScript:直接使用 JavaScript 语言本身,无需使用任何库。
React:一个用于构建高效、可扩展和可重用 UI 组件的 JavaScript 库。
Angular:一个完整的框架,用于构建单页面应用程序 (SPA) 和复杂的 UI。

使用 JavaScript 构建交互式 UI 的最佳实践

在使用 JavaScript 构建交互式 UI 时,遵循最佳实践至关重要:
保持代码简洁:使用可复用代码和模块化设计来提高代码的可维护性和可读性。
优化性能:使用缓存和惰性加载来减少页面加载时间并提高用户体验。
处理错误:实施健壮的错误处理机制以处理意外问题,并向用户提供有意义的反馈。
遵循 Web 标准:遵守 HTML、CSS 和 JavaScript 标准以确保跨浏览器兼容性和可访问性。

JavaScript 在 UI 设计中的示例

以下是一些 JavaScript 在 UI 设计中使用的示例:
创建带有动态内容的交互式幻灯片。
实现可展开的菜单或下拉菜单以节省屏幕空间。
构建带有即时验证的实时表单,提供更好的用户体验。
实现带有拖放功能的交互式可视化工具。
构建聊天应用程序或流媒体播放器等实时应用程序。


通过利用 JavaScript 的强大功能,UI 设计师和开发者能够构建动态、交互式且用户友好的用户界面。了解 JavaScript 在 UI 设计中的作用、技术和最佳实践,可以显着提升数字产品的用户体验。

2024-12-19


上一篇:Javascript 实现图片切换

下一篇:遍历 JavaScript 对象